Ever had a day so heavy you just couldn’t hold it together? In this vulnerable episode, I share what happened when I broke down in tears at work—and how my supervisors responded with compassion, truth, and a powerful reminder: we all need help sometimes.I talk about what it means to be part of a real community, even as homesteaders, and how lifting where we stand can change everything. This one’s raw, but it’s real.
